7039 Aluminum Alloy Plate

7039 aluminum alloy is a medium and high strength Al-Zn-Mg aluminum alloy developed by the United States. It has excellent welding performance, elastic resistance and good processing and formability, and is widely used as a gun frame and armor structure. 7039 is used for refrigerated containers, cryogenic equipment and storage boxes, fire-fighting pressure equipment, military equipment, armor plates, and missile installations. 7039 aluminum alloy is an aluminum alloy principally containing zinc (3.5–4.5%) as an alloying element. It is heat treatable wrought aluminum alloy. It is used for making armour suites.

Chemical Composition

Chemical Elements

Metric

English

Aluminum, Al 

90.5 - 94 %

90.5 - 94 %

Chromium, Cr 

0.15 - 0.25 %

0.15 - 0.25 %

Copper, Cu 

<= 0.10 %

<= 0.10 %

Iron, Fe 

<= 0.40 %

<= 0.40 %

Magnesium, Mg 

2.3 - 3.3 %

2.3 - 3.3 %

Manganese, Mn 

0.10 - 0.40 %

0.10 - 0.40 %

Other, each 

<= 0.05 %

<= 0.05 %

Other, total 

<= 0.15 %

<= 0.15 %

Silicon, Si 

<= 0.30 %

<= 0.30 %

Titanium, Ti 

<= 0.10 %

<= 0.10 %

Zinc, Zn 

3.5 - 4.5 %

3.5 - 4.5 %

Process Properties

Heat Treating T Temper Codes for Aluminium 7039 Plates:

T1 – Cooled from an elevated temperature shaping process and naturally aged to a substantially stable condition.
T2 – Cooled from an elevated temperature shaping process, cold worked, and naturally aged to a substantially stable condition.
T3 – Solution heat treated, cold worked, and naturally aged to a substantially stable condition.
T4 – Solution heat treated, and naturally aged to a substantially stable condition.
T5 – Cooled from an elevated temperature shaping process then artificially aged.
T6 – Solution heat treated then artificially aged.
T7 – Solution heat treated then overaged/stabilized.
T8 – Solution heat treated, cold worked, then artificially aged.
T9 – Solution heat treated, artificially aged, then cold worked.
T10 – Cooled from an elevated temperature shaping process, cold worked, then artificially aged.
Additional digits may be used after the first T temper digit to indicate subsequent stress relieving by processes such as stretching, compressing, or a combination.


H Temper Strain Hardening Codes for Aluminium 7039 Plates:

H1 – Strain hardened only
H2 – Strain hardened and partially annealed
H3 – Strain hardened and stabilized
H4 – Strain hardened and lacquered or painted. This assumes that thermal affects from the coating process affect the strain hardening; seldom encountered.
